Product details

Overview

ACST6-7SR from STMicroelectronics is an overvoltage-protected AC switch (integrated triac + clamping structure) designed for mains-powered static switching in home appliances and industrial controls. It delivers 6 A RMS on-state current, 800 V blocking voltage (VDRM/VRRM), and low 10 mA gate trigger current (IGT), enabling direct MCU drive without external snubbers in compressor or universal motor control.

For engineers reviewing the ACST6-7SR datasheet, ACST6-7SR pinout, ACST6-7SR application, or ACST6-7SR equivalent, this device serves as a self-protected, high-noise-immunity alternative to standard triacs in IEC 61000-4-4/4-5-compliant AC load switching-especially where board space, component count, and transient resilience are critical.

Technical Context

The ACST6-7SR integrates a planar triac with an internal high-voltage crowbar clamping structure that activates at ≥850 V (VCL) to safely absorb inductive turn-off energy and withstand 2 kV line surges per IEC 61000-4-5. Its dV/dt immunity exceeds 500 V/µs at 125 °C with gate open, and it sustains 100 A/µs critical dI/dt during commutation.

It operates across –40 to +125 °C junction temperature, features 1500 VRMS insulation (TO-220FPAB package), and achieves 4.25 °C/W junction-to-case thermal resistance-enabling reliable 6 A conduction at TC = 92 °C without forced cooling.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
IT(RMS) 6 A - Sustains continuous 6 A AC load current (e.g., fridge compressor) at TC = 92 °C without heatsink derating.
VDRM/VRRM 800 V - Blocks full AC mains peaks (e.g., 230 VRMS × √2 ≈ 325 V) with 2.5× safety margin for surge transients.
IGT 10 mA max - Enables direct drive from MCU GPIO via single series resistor (no buffer IC required).
VCL ≥850 V - Clamps line transients before destructive breakdown, eliminating need for external MOVs or RC snubbers.
dV/dt (gate open) ≥500 V/µs at 125 °C - Prevents false triggering from fast EFT bursts (IEC 61000-4-4) without gate filtering.
Rth(j-c) 4.25 °C/W - Delivers efficient heat transfer to heatsink, supporting compact thermal design in sealed appliance enclosures.
I2t (tp = 10 ms) 13 A²s - Supports fuse coordination for short-circuit protection without nuisance blowing during motor startup inrush.

Pinout & Package

ACST6-7SR uses the TO-220FPAB insulated package (1500 VRMS isolation, epoxy UL94 V0 rated), with metal tab electrically isolated from all terminals. Mounting torque: 0.4–0.6 N·m.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
G Gate Low-current trigger input (≤10 mA); referenced to COM; enables zero-crossing or phase-angle control via MCU.
OUT Main output terminal (anode 2) Carries full load current (6 A RMS); connects to AC load (e.g., motor winding); bidirectional conduction path.
COM Common reference (anode 1 / MT1) Return path for load current; tied to neutral or AC line reference; defines voltage reference for gate and clamping circuitry.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Integrated overvoltage protection Self-contained crowbar clamping (VCL ≥ 850 V) eliminates external MOVs/snubbers and meets IEC 61000-4-5 Level 4.
High noise immunity 500 V/µs dV/dt rating and 100 A/µs dI/dt capability ensure robust operation in EMI-heavy environments (e.g., washing machine control boards).
Direct MCU drivability 10 mA IGT allows single-resistor interface to 3.3 V/5 V microcontrollers-no level-shifting or driver IC needed.
Thermal reliability Planar die construction and 4.25 °C/W Rth(j-c) support stable 6 A operation at 92 °C case temperature in confined spaces.
Inductive load compatibility No external snubber required for 6 A inductive loads (e.g., universal motors, compressors) due to built-in energy absorption.

FAQ

What is the maximum ambient temperature for ACST6-7SR in free-air convection?

In free-air convection (no heatsink), ACST6-7SR supports up to 62 °C ambient temperature for 6 A RMS operation when mounted on a 1 cm² copper pad (per D²PAK variant data). For TO-220FPAB, derating begins above 45 °C ambient without forced airflow-consult Figure 4 in Doc ID 7297 Rev 10 for exact IT(RMS) vs. Ta curves.

Does ACST6-7SR require a heatsink for 6 A continuous operation?

Yes-6 A RMS operation requires mounting on a heatsink. At TC = 92 °C (TO-220FPAB), the device sustains full current; this corresponds to ~40–45 °C heatsink temperature depending on thermal interface and airflow. Without a heatsink, maximum continuous current drops to ~1.5 A (see Figure 3).

Can ACST6-7SR replace a standard triac like BT139-800 in existing designs?

Yes-ACST6-7SR is pin-compatible with BT139-800 in TO-220AB packages (G, OUT, COM mapping matches), but adds integrated overvoltage protection and higher dV/dt immunity. No layout change is needed, though external snubbers/MOVs can be removed to reduce BOM cost and board area.

What is the clamping response time of ACST6-7SR during a 2 kV surge?

Clamping occurs within <100 ns of voltage exceeding VCL (≥850 V), initiating crowbar action that forces the device into low-impedance conduction. Full current conduction (IPEAK ≈ 120 A) is achieved within 1 µs, dissipating surge energy through the load-verified per IEC 61000-4-5 test waveform (1.2/50 µs voltage, 8/20 µs current).
